Introduce _Streambuf_sink that writes directly to basic_streambuf
via sputn, preferring zero-copy writes into the streambuf put area
(pptr/epptr/pbump) and falling back to the stack buffer and bulk
sputn.

libstdc++-v3/ChangeLog:

        * include/bits/streambuf_iterator.h (ostreambuf_iterator):
        Add internal _M_get_sbuf() member.
        * include/std/format: Include <bits/streambuf_iterator.h>.
        (__format::_Streambuf_sink): New class template.
        * include/std/streambuf: Forward-declare __format::_Streambuf_sink,
        add friend declaration to basic_streambuf.

+  // A format sink that writes directly to a basic_streambuf.
+  // Prefers zero-copy writes into the streambuf's put area
+  // (pptr/epptr/pbump), falling back to the stack buffer
+  // (_M_buf) and bulk sputn.
+  template<typename _CharT, typename _Traits = char_traits<_CharT>>
+    class _Streambuf_sink : public _Buf_sink<_CharT>
+    {
+      using _Buf_sink<_CharT>::_M_buf;
+
+    protected:
+      enum class _Sink_state { _S_stack, _S_put_area };
+
+      basic_streambuf<_CharT, _Traits>* _M_sbuf;
+      _Sink_state _M_state = _Sink_state::_S_stack;
+
+      // Switch to _M_buf when the streambuf has no put area
+      // or we need to stop using it.
+      void
+      _M_use_stackbuf()
+      {
+       this->_M_reset(_M_buf);
+       _M_state = _Sink_state::_S_stack;
+      }
+
+      // Try to point our span directly into the streambuf's put
+      // area for zero-copy writes.  Caller must fall back to
+      // _M_use_stackbuf() on failure.
+      bool
+      _M_use_put_area(size_t __n = 0)
+      {
+       if (auto __p = _M_sbuf->pptr())
+         {
+           auto __e = _M_sbuf->epptr();
+           if (__e && __e > __p
+               && static_cast<size_t>(__e - __p) >= __n)
+             {
+               this->_M_reset(
+                 span<_CharT>{__p, static_cast<size_t>(__e - __p)});
+               _M_state = _Sink_state::_S_put_area;
+               return true;
+             }
+         }
+       return false;
+      }
+
+      // Allow derived classes to commit to the put area
+      // without needing friendship to basic_streambuf.
+      void
+      _M_pbump(streamsize __n)
+      { _M_sbuf->__safe_pbump(__n); }
+
+      _GLIBCXX_CONSTEXPR_FORMAT void
+      _M_overflow() override
+      {
+       auto __s = this->_M_used();
+       if (__s.empty()) [[unlikely]]
+         return;
+
+       switch (_M_state)
+       {
+         case _Sink_state::_S_stack:
+           // _Iter_sink overrides _M_overflow and calls
+           // _M_out._M_put(), which checks sputn's return
+           // value and tracks failure on the iterator.
+           _M_sbuf->sputn(__s.data(), __s.size());
+           break;
+         case _Sink_state::_S_put_area:
+           _M_sbuf->__safe_pbump(__s.size());
+           break;
+       }
+
+       if (!_M_use_put_area())
+         _M_use_stackbuf();
+      }
+
+    public:
+      [[__gnu__::__always_inline__]]
+      constexpr explicit
+      _Streambuf_sink(basic_streambuf<_CharT, _Traits>* __sbuf) noexcept
+      : _M_sbuf(__sbuf)
+      { }
+
+      using _Sink<_CharT>::out;
+
+      _GLIBCXX_CONSTEXPR_FORMAT typename _Sink<_CharT>::_Reservation
+      _M_reserve(size_t __n) override
+      {
+       if (__n <= this->_M_unused().size())
+         return { this };
+
+       if (!this->_M_used().empty())
+         _M_overflow();
+
+       // Try to write directly into the streambuf's put area.
+       if (_M_use_put_area(__n))
+         return { this };
+
+       // Otherwise reset to the stack buffer.
+       _M_use_stackbuf();
+       if (__n <= this->_M_unused().size())
+         return { this };
+
+       return { nullptr };
+      }
+    };
